Portuguese

Etymology

in- +‎ segurança (security), from segurar (to hold; to secure) +‎ -ança.

Noun

insegurança f (plural s)

  1. (uncountable) insecurity (lack of security)
  2. something one is not self-confident about
  3. vulnerability
